ResourceWorld Data Center for Paleoclimatology - Corals and Sclerosponges
Coral data at the World Data Center consist of stable isotope and trace metal analyses from corals located around the globe. Corals serve as proxies of upper ocean environment, such as sea surface temperature and salinity, over the past several centuries.
